Description

The Independence of Peru has been extensively researched, although with a focus primarily on the patriots. This publication seeks to balance the perspective by also analyzing the royalist sectors: their motivations, contributions, and the consequences they faced for defending the crown. Unlike other studies oriented to the political sphere, it proposes a regional history with an emphasis on the social dimension of men and women who fought for the viceroyalty. Its value also lies in the use of unpublished documents found in regional, national, and international repositories, which provides a renewed perspective of the independence process.

Author: David QUICHUA CHAICO
